1.PrepareFluorescamineworkingsolution:AddthewholecontentofDMSO(ComponentB)intothebottleofFluorescamine(ComponentA),andmixwell.
Note:2.5mLoffluorescamineworkingsolutionisenoughfor1plate.Unusedfluorescamineworkingsolutionshouldbestoredinsingleusealiquotsat-20oCandprotectedfromlight.
2.PrepareBSAstandardsolutions:DilutetheappropriateamountofBSAStandard,1mg/mL(ComponentC)intoPBStogetaBSAconcentrationof100-1.56µg/mLwith2Xdilutions.

3.Runproteinassay:
3.1 AddtheserialdilutionsofBSAstandardat75μL/well(seeTables1&2)intothe96-wellplate.A0µg/mLBSAcontrolisincludedasblankcontrol.
3.2 Add25μL/welloffluorescamineworkingsolution(fromStep1)intoBSAstandard,blankcontrol,andtestsamples(seeStep2,Table1)tomakethetotalassayvolumeof100µL/well.
Note:Fora384-wellplate,add30μLofsampleand10μLoffluorescamineworkingsolutionintoeachwell.
3.3 Incubatethereactionatroomtemperaturefor5to30minutes,protectedfromlight.
3.4 MonitorthefluorescenceincreasewithafluorescenceplatereaderatEx/Em=380/470nm.

1.模板提取(一般为RNA):Trizol、氯仿、异丙醇、无水乙醇、DEPC处理水
2.模板浓度测定:分光光度计或NanoDrop
3.逆转录:逆转录试剂盒(或者一步法试剂盒),这一步可以用普通PCR做,也可以用水域做。
4.荧光定量PCR试剂:通常有用SYBR Green Mix做的,但是这里建议你用EvaGreen做,灵敏度和平行性都要好于SYBR Green,并且如果你那是ABI或者Stratagene的PCR如果用SYBR Green还需要加一步Rox很麻烦。
5.其他:除了以上的那些还需要离心管、PCR管或板(Axygen反应比较好)、移液枪等,暂时就想到这么多。
